    difference between m998 and 1123 ?

    Having just researched this for my state (Virginia) here's what I found out. Other states will of course be different: I called the Virginia Department of Environmental Quality (the DEQ) and they said that in VA, only diesel vehicles that are OBD-II compliant are subject to emissions testing...
